== Appearance ==
== Appearance ==
   
   
[[Image:HereticArmor.jpg|right|thumb|200px|Clan armor seen in [[Halo Wars: Genesis]] that the Heretic armor resembles.]]
[[Image:HereticArmor.jpg|right|thumb|200px|Clan armor seen in [[Halo Wars: Genesis]] that the Heretic armor resembles.]]
Having abandoned the inclusive culture and ideals of the Covenant entirely, [[Sesa 'Refumee]] decided to carry a new banner for his troops: the beige and gold colors of the original [[Sangheili]] homeworld. The Elites and [[Grunts]] donned new armor of these colors as well as outfittings to help them survive in the Hydrogen atmosphere of the [[Threshold]] [[Gas Mine]]. The armor, although protective, appears to be much more ornate and ceremonial than the Covenant standard issue armor, although the armor also may be re-painted and stripped down from the original Covenant armor. It appears, however, that the armor resembles greatly that worn by the Sangheili clan in [[Halo Wars: Genesis]]. It is plausible that the "Heretic armor" is in fact a clan-based armor that the Elites use outside of the Covenant military structure.
